About Diana

Before describing my academic credentials, I want you to get to know me as a fellow human who wants to walk with you through this journey of discovery and growth. Why does this matter? During our work together, I’m asking you to become vulnerable and share some of your deepest stories and emotions with me in order to help you work through the issue(s) that landed you to working with me.

Part of this work is that you grow to trust me and trust must be earned; this is my chance to start working on earning that from you. I hold a non-judgmental, compassionate, and sex-positive approach for my clients first and foremost and my techniques and modalities are weaved into a pleasure-focused approach.

Sexuality has always been my passion. As a person who feels incredibly comfortable and open to having these conversations, I’ve experienced, first-hand, how our society views and discusses topics around sex and sexuality, particularly in relationships. I have experienced the shame, guilt, embarrassment, and discomfort around sexuality, both personally and professionally, and have made it my purpose to help as many people as I can heal from sex negativity. You should be able to ask the questions that are on your mind about sex and about your relationship and get an open and honest answer without any judgement and be welcomed with genuine interest and curiosity. I want to help spread the sexual positivity that I experience to as many people as I can, including you.

I believe that all of us are striving to find connection and safety with ourselves and others. It takes great authenticity and vulnerability to do this and I am honoured to be a part of my clients’ journeys and to create space for you to do this, especially around sexuality which has a huge impact on our lives. My goal is to help people just like you develop healthy relationships with their partners, their families, and most importantly, themselves. My work is specialized in difficulties with desire, sexual and genital pain, and healing from sexual trauma, as well as LGBTQ+ couples issues.
